Why did they split the community apart?

They’re all different versions of the game offering differing styles of gameplay. Retail is endgame only. The Classics tend to be a mix of old guard like me who think MMO means leveling alts, and other people that just want to raid log.

WoW started as an idea of a playground with a bunch of different activities people could engage with. It turned out that WoW gamers are more niche players than generalists; they find the playtype they like and they stick almost exclusively with that.

Now the one world playground is segregating into differing playstyle niches.
